In this session, Dr. Heidi covers:
- Why weight management matters - and the important role that metabolism, muscle mass, and nutrition play in keeping your dog at a healthy weight over time
- Signs to watch for - including reduced energy, weight gain or loss, changes in appetite, reluctance to exercise, and other indicators that your dog's metabolism may need extra support
- The weight-mobility-vitality connection - how body condition and overall health can influence joint comfort, energy, and long-term wellbeing
How to Support Your Dog's Weight Management & Metabolism
Dr. Heidi also shares practical tips to help maintain a healthy weight and steady energy:
- Start early - metabolic support isn't just for less active or senior dogs; building healthy habits early can make a real difference later in life
- Support from within - using daily nutrition and supplements that help support metabolic health, lean muscle, and overall vitality
- Stay consistent - small daily habits that can help promote a healthy weight and long-term wellbeing
